What is Gauge Welded Wire Fencing?


Gauge welded wire fencing consists of thin wire strands that are welded together at specific intervals to create a strong and durable mesh. The “gauge” refers to the thickness of the wire; the higher the gauge number, the thinner the wire. A lower gauge (for instance, 4 or 6) indicates a thicker wire, which translates into increased strength and resistance to deformation. Typically, gauges for welded wire fencing range from 14 to 9, with lower gauges being more suitable for heavy-duty applications.


Benefits of Gauge Welded Wire Fencing


One of the most significant advantages of gauge welded wire fencing is its strength. The welded joints provide a more robust structure compared to woven wire fences, which can sag over time. This enhanced stability makes welded wire fencing ideal for containing livestock and securing property lines.


Moreover, gauge welded wire fences require minimal maintenance. Unlike wood fencing that may rot or require regular staining or painting, welded wire fencing is resistant to weather conditions and animal wear. A simple wash with water occasionally can keep it looking good as new.

Another benefit is its versatility. Welded wire fences come in various heights and mesh sizes, making them suitable for different applications, from protecting gardens to enclosing large agricultural fields. They can also be customized with barbed wire or electric systems for added security.


Aesthetic and Functional Features


Though primarily functional, gauge welded wire fences can also be aesthetically pleasing. They create a clean, open look while maintaining visibility for monitoring your surroundings. This transparency can help integrate the fence into the landscape seamlessly, allowing for unobstructed views while keeping pets and livestock confined.


Additionally, gauge welded wire fences are eco-friendly. Being made from recyclable materials, they are a sustainable choice for environmentally conscious consumers. They also offer a longer lifespan, which reduces the need for replacements and conserves resources.
